

Paul Manning, 63, of Ponte Vedra Beach, Florida, formerly of Brunswick, died Wednesday, November 10, 2010 at Baptist Beaches Hospital in Jacksonville Beach, Florida. Funeral services will be held at 11AM Saturday, November 13, 2010 in the chapel of Edo Miller and Sons Funeral Home with
Rev. Bobby Miller of Tampa, FL and Ron Scarboro officiating. Interment will follow in Evergreen Memorial Park Cemetery with Tim Young, Chris Cathey, Eron Dorsett, Scott Diehl, Lee Moon, and Gurkan Karagul serving as pallbearers. Honorary pallbearers will be Keith Campbell, Eule Jones, Sonny Ryals, Sam Pierce, Rudy Underwood, and Wayne Harper.
Born November 5, 1947 in Tampa, Florida to the late Everett and Bessie Mobley Manning, he was a retired sales representative for Standard Distributing. He was a graduate of Glynn Academy and a Navy Veteran, serving during the Vietnam Era. Mr. Manning had been a resident of Brunswick before moving to Ponte Vedra Beach in 2005. Mr. Manning was an avid golfer and fisherman, but mostly enjoyed spending time with his grandchildren. He will be greatly missed. In addition to his parents he was preceded in death by his wife, Janice Haddon Manning, and a twin sister, Paulette Manning Butts.
Survivors include a son, Paul Manning and wife Nichole, two grandsons, Trey Manning and Luke Manning all of Jacksonville, a sister, Gwen Knight of Ft. Lauderdale, several nieces and nephews and extended family.
